The size of Korora is approximately 16.7 square kilometres. There are 8 parks, covering nearly 41.0% of the total area. The population of Korora in 2016 was 2488 people. By 2021 the population was 2740 showing a population growth of 10.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Korora is 60-69 years. Households in Korora are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Korora work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 76.10% of the homes in Korora were owner-occupied compared with 71.70% in 2016.
